Anne of Avonlea : Anne of Green Gables :/ L.M. Montgomery.

Summary:

Five years after coming to Green Gables, Anne is 'half past sixteen' and about to start teaching at her old school, with high hopes of inspiring youthful hearts and minds with ideals and ambitions. But some of her pupils have quite other ideas. Meanwhile, the young orphan Davy and the Avonlea Improvement Society bring their own headaches for a headstrong girl trying to grow up.
